August Eco- Tip from A Rocha
Looking after wildlife in the heat. Times of drought and dryness can be dangerous for wildlife. Provide water for birds and insects – put a dish of water out to help wildlife stay hydrated. Insects, small mammals, birds, and even badgers, foxes, and deer could benefit. A stone in a plant saucer helps bees to perch and drink without drowning. These small actions make a big difference and are just some of the ways we can live out our calling to care for God’s creation.
